We are delighted to announce that following representations by us more investment into roads within Prudhoe will take place funded from a £7.7m grant from HM Government.
A long overdue carriageway resurfacing of the front street in Prudhoe will be carried early in the new year at a cost of £250,000
In addition another £150,000 will be invested into the Dukes way industrial estate.
